Tariff Preference Level (TPL) for Certain Textile Shipments

A reminder to clients utilizing Certificates of Eligibility to obtain preferential duty treatment that TPL entries released within 2016 must be filed by December 31, 2016 to be considered timely by CBP.  Please note that December 31st is a Saturday this year making the actual cutoff for filing Friday December 30th.

Willson International Inc. requires time to obtain a Certificate of Eligibility and process the entry summary for timely submission to CBP.  Due to the filing deadline in place by CBP, our TPL filing cutoff date will be Monday December 19th.

Shipments released after December 19th will not be guaranteed filing by the December 30th deadline.  Please remember that the release date of the shipment is the actual date the carrier crosses the border and the entry is arrived by CBP.  This may not necessarily be the date that the release request was processed.  We ask that you coordinate crossing dates with your carriers accordingly.

While we will make every effort to file all TPL shipments released in 2016 timely for the calendar year, we cannot guarantee the timely submission of any shipments cleared after December 19, 2016.  Any additional duties incurred resulting from a Certificate of Eligibility being denied will be the direct responsibility of the Importer of Record, not Willson International Inc.
